ISLAMABAD: Around 38,150 Pakistani pilgrims under the government鈥檚 Hajj scheme have arrived in the holy cities of Makkah and Madinah ahead of this year鈥檚 annual Islamic pilgrimage, the state-run Associated Press of Pakistan (APP) reported recently.听

This year, around 179,210 Pakistanis will perform Hajj under both the government and private schemes, for which a month-long flight operation started on May 9. This year鈥檚 pilgrimage is expected to run from June 14-19.

鈥淏y Sunday, collectively as many as 38,150 Pakistani pilgrims, which constitutes almost 54.35 percent of the total, have reached Madinah and Makkah,鈥 the APP report said on Sunday, citing sources in the Pakistan Hajj Mission.听

From May 17, the Pakistan Hajj Mission started sending bus caravans of pilgrims to Makkah from Madinah after they completed their eight-day stay in Madinah. Over 23,464 Pakistani pilgrims have reached Makkah from Madinah under a real-time GPS tracking system, APP said, adding that it is for the first time that the service is being utilized to track the movement of Hajj caravans.听

鈥淭his innovative approach aims to ensure a seamless and timely journey for the pilgrims,鈥 Shahid Ur Rehman Marth, who is in-charge of the Madinah Departure Cell, told APP.听

Meanwhile, pilgrims from all over the world including Pakistan, visited the sacred cave of Hira at the mountain of Al-Noor in Makkah.听

The site is a revered one for Muslims around the world as it is the place where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him) received the first verses of the Holy Qur鈥檃n from God.听
Hajj is one of the five pillars of Islam and requires every adult Muslim to undertake the journey to the holy Islamic sites in Makkah at least once in their lifetime, provided they are financially and physically able to do so.
Pilgrims from Pakistan鈥檚 southern port city of Karachi are availing the Makkah Route Initiative facility for the first time. Launched in 2019, the initiative allows for the completion of immigration procedures at the pilgrims鈥 country of departure.听
This makes it possible to bypass long immigration and customs checks upon reaching 黑料社区, which significantly reduces the waiting time and makes the entry process smoother and faster.听
